Output 8b60aec7113df762e79504b2f14b88b68aed62c7c02de60f57510c2bcfb1afb8:1

value
287506968
script pubkey
OP_0 OP_PUSHBYTES_20 6ef3f776ec64835bea49111727cf6d682ce1a59a
address
bc1qdmelwahvvjp4h6jfzytj0nmddqkwrfv66ya0y4
transaction
8b60aec7113df762e79504b2f14b88b68aed62c7c02de60f57510c2bcfb1afb8
spent
true